Zoho Creator users are familiar with the Look Up field. A lookup field establishes a relationship between two forms in such a way that each parent record is associated with only one child record. Subforms are the next logical step. Subforms are of use in scenarios where each parent record needs to be associated with multiple child records, giving rise to one to many relationships.
While the parent form shows data from the "one" side of the relationship, the subform shows data from the "many" side of the relationship.
The subform is inserted into the parent form. Thus the parent and child records are displayed in one place eliminating the need to switch between forms.

Any new feature in Zoho Creator, comes with some Deluge Power to it. Subforms are scriptable too. Users can add workflows and business rules to the parent form and to the subform. And yes you guessed it right. All in one place. The subform itself is listed among the fields in the script builder. Not just that, The “On Add Row” and “On Delete Row” are 2 new tasks meant for Subforms. These tasks can be executed when a child record is added to or deleted from the subform.
